| Copies of the receipts & the forms you filled out. Rebates are never 100%. Sometimes something legitimately happens (such as lost in the mail) & sometimes it just seems like they are out not to pay you regardless of how well you document things. However, your chances of recovering and getting your rebate can be greatly improved when you keep a copy of your documentation. Since most of them go through, it may seem like a wasted effort sometimes. However, when I recovered my $55 appliance delivery rebate from Home Depot because I had all my documentation, it paid for the AIO printer I use to make all my copies.... I have done many rebates & having copies has paid off several times. As sbombria is finding out the hard way - if you don't have documentation, you can't prove anything to fight back & get your money. With rebates you are assumed guilty of violating the terms until proven innocent. |

| I usually try to make copies, though sometimes it's last minute and I don't bother. I've had one Walgreen's rebate go missing, and fortunately I had the copies. Now, Office Depot seems to be out to rip me off--out of 6 rebates from this summer's school supply sales, 2 mysteriously were missing something. These are all sent separately, so it's not like I left something out of one envelope that affected 2 rebates. Unfortunately I didn't always make copies of them because they were about $5--but I wish I had, because these were things I would not have bought. OP--if you do try to get the store to find the records for you, you should probably call and talk about it with the manager during a non-busy time. When they had to print mine because the printer jammed (and this was 45 minutes after the transaction), even that was very time-consuming. Good luck! |
